Sunday 21 November 2021

Treadstone48 and Rhymestone

 Documentation

 
Hex released from author
https://github.com/marksard/qmk_firmware_hex/releases 
 
Hardware from github by author
https://github.com/marksard/Keyboards 

Firmware from github
https://github.com/qmk/qmk_firmware/tree/master/keyboards/treadstone48

Other link from the author
https://scrapbox.io/marksard/Treadstone48

For Treadstone48 + Rhymestone

Advise from author: this directory is written for the above combination. Flash single rhymestone and treadstone48 with the same hex produced from this directory.
 
 
Some notes on split for vial.json
 
2021-11-22
-  Oled only working on master treadstone48; none on rhymestone
-  RGB light only rainbow swirl, rainbow mood, static gradient, rgb test
-  Mousekey and mediakey enabled
-  Via enabled, manual sideload json to remap
 * The firmware size is approaching the maximum - 27830/28672 (97%, 842 bytes free)
 
 
 
or browse the following website by add manual json (does not support firefox browser)
https://remap-keys.app/ 
 
 

Treadstone48 only

json file (provided by the author as in 
[Hex released from author
https://github.com/marksard/qmk_firmware_hex/releases])

hex file same as above


Rhymestone only

Rhymestone left and right (use as 30% board)
json file load here 
[Hex released from author
https://github.com/marksard/qmk_firmware_hex/releases])
 










 

Saturday 13 November 2021

Sesame reconfigure

 Task: To check on discord for solution

(

already disabled mousekeys, extra key enable, no console

ISSUE as follow

Compiling: tmk_core/protocol/vusb/vusb.c                                                           tmk_core/protocol/vusb/vusb.c:77:6: error: #error There are not enough available interfaces to support all functions. Please disable one or more of the following: Mouse Keys, Extra Keys, Raw HID, Console
 #    error There are not enough available interfaces to support all functions. Please disable one or more of the following: Mouse Keys, Extra Keys, Raw HID, Console
      ^~~~~
tmk_core/protocol/vusb/vusb.c:81:6: error: #error Mouse/Extra Keys share an endpoint with Console. Please disable one of the two.
 #    error Mouse/Extra Keys share an endpoint with Console. Please disable one of the two.
      ^~~~~
 [ERRORS]



Tuesday 9 November 2021

1x!Numpad documentation

 Design Notes

-




Tutorial to Remap keys

VIA 

1. Download VIA software here
 
win platform
 other platforms

2. Download json file below

3. Install VIA, click File, import keymap. Choose the json file you downloaded in step2
 
 
 4. You can now start remapping in VIA. You dont need to save, it reflects directly once you assign.


VIAL

1. Download VIAL software here

2. Start remap your keys, scroll wheel and rotary encoder. 
3. Json file is not required in VIAL.



below for advanced user

Firmware Downloads

20211110

Json download (to load it in VIA)
Hex download for backup
Files keymap download

- Ported with VIA and VIAL
- Programmable rotation for scroll wheel and rotary encoder through VIAL
- Enabled all rgb lighting
- Up to 5 layers configuration 
- Oleds inspired from Yampad (shows layer, stats such as num, cap, scr)
- Mousekey enabled
- QMK settings, tap dance, and combo are disabled in VIAL to save storage
 
 
 

20211213

 Hex download here
Check this link to see how to flash the board; remember to save your layout or keymap by SAVE+LOAD > Save Current Layout. Load this saved layout after you flash with the new hex above. Do note that this json file is different from "Json download to load in VIA" above. 

- removed "keep going", replaced with exclamation mark